| Package | Description |
|---|---|
| org.apache.archiva.metadata.repository |
| Modifier and Type | Method and Description |
|---|---|
void |
AbstractMetadataRepository.addMetadataFacet(String repositoryId,
org.apache.archiva.metadata.model.MetadataFacet metadataFacet) |
void |
MetadataRepository.addMetadataFacet(String repositoryId,
org.apache.archiva.metadata.model.MetadataFacet metadataFacet) |
void |
AbstractMetadataRepository.close() |
void |
MetadataRepository.close() |
List<org.apache.archiva.metadata.model.ArtifactMetadata> |
AbstractMetadataRepository.getArtifacts(String repositoryId) |
List<org.apache.archiva.metadata.model.ArtifactMetadata> |
MetadataRepository.getArtifacts(String repositoryId) |
Collection<org.apache.archiva.metadata.model.ArtifactMetadata> |
AbstractMetadataRepository.getArtifactsByChecksum(String repositoryId,
String checksum) |
Collection<org.apache.archiva.metadata.model.ArtifactMetadata> |
MetadataRepository.getArtifactsByChecksum(String repositoryId,
String checksum) |
List<org.apache.archiva.metadata.model.ArtifactMetadata> |
AbstractMetadataRepository.getArtifactsByDateRange(String repositoryId,
Date startTime,
Date endTime) |
List<org.apache.archiva.metadata.model.ArtifactMetadata> |
MetadataRepository.getArtifactsByDateRange(String repositoryId,
Date startTime,
Date endTime)
if startTime or endTime are
null they are not used for search |
List<org.apache.archiva.metadata.model.ArtifactMetadata> |
AbstractMetadataRepository.getArtifactsByMetadata(String key,
String value,
String repositoryId) |
List<org.apache.archiva.metadata.model.ArtifactMetadata> |
MetadataRepository.getArtifactsByMetadata(String key,
String value,
String repositoryId)
Get artifacts with an artifact metadata key that matches the passed value.
|
List<org.apache.archiva.metadata.model.ArtifactMetadata> |
AbstractMetadataRepository.getArtifactsByProjectVersionMetadata(String key,
String value,
String repositoryId) |
List<org.apache.archiva.metadata.model.ArtifactMetadata> |
MetadataRepository.getArtifactsByProjectVersionMetadata(String key,
String value,
String repositoryId)
Get artifacts with a project version metadata key that matches the passed value.
|
List<org.apache.archiva.metadata.model.ArtifactMetadata> |
AbstractMetadataRepository.getArtifactsByProperty(String key,
String value,
String repositoryId) |
List<org.apache.archiva.metadata.model.ArtifactMetadata> |
MetadataRepository.getArtifactsByProperty(String key,
String value,
String repositoryId)
Get artifacts with a property key that matches the passed value.
|
org.apache.archiva.metadata.model.MetadataFacet |
AbstractMetadataRepository.getMetadataFacet(String repositoryId,
String facetId,
String name) |
org.apache.archiva.metadata.model.MetadataFacet |
MetadataRepository.getMetadataFacet(String repositoryId,
String facetId,
String name) |
List<String> |
AbstractMetadataRepository.getMetadataFacets(String repositoryId,
String facetId) |
List<String> |
MetadataRepository.getMetadataFacets(String repositoryId,
String facetId) |
Collection<String> |
AbstractMetadataRepository.getRepositories() |
Collection<String> |
MetadataRepository.getRepositories() |
boolean |
AbstractMetadataRepository.hasMetadataFacet(String repositoryId,
String facetId) |
boolean |
MetadataRepository.hasMetadataFacet(String repositoryId,
String facetId) |
<T> T |
AbstractMetadataRepository.obtainAccess(Class<T> aClass) |
<T> T |
MetadataRepository.obtainAccess(Class<T> aClass) |
void |
AbstractMetadataRepository.removeArtifact(org.apache.archiva.metadata.model.ArtifactMetadata artifactMetadata,
String baseVersion) |
void |
MetadataRepository.removeArtifact(org.apache.archiva.metadata.model.ArtifactMetadata artifactMetadata,
String baseVersion)
used for deleting timestamped version of SNAPSHOT artifacts
|
void |
AbstractMetadataRepository.removeArtifact(String repositoryId,
String namespace,
String project,
String version,
org.apache.archiva.metadata.model.MetadataFacet metadataFacet) |
void |
MetadataRepository.removeArtifact(String repositoryId,
String namespace,
String project,
String version,
org.apache.archiva.metadata.model.MetadataFacet metadataFacet)
FIXME need a unit test!!!
Only remove
MetadataFacet for the artifact |
void |
AbstractMetadataRepository.removeArtifact(String repositoryId,
String namespace,
String project,
String version,
String id) |
void |
MetadataRepository.removeArtifact(String repositoryId,
String namespace,
String project,
String version,
String id) |
void |
AbstractMetadataRepository.removeMetadataFacet(String repositoryId,
String facetId,
String name) |
void |
MetadataRepository.removeMetadataFacet(String repositoryId,
String facetId,
String name) |
void |
AbstractMetadataRepository.removeMetadataFacets(String repositoryId,
String facetId) |
void |
MetadataRepository.removeMetadataFacets(String repositoryId,
String facetId) |
void |
AbstractMetadataRepository.removeNamespace(String repositoryId,
String namespace) |
void |
MetadataRepository.removeNamespace(String repositoryId,
String namespace) |
void |
AbstractMetadataRepository.removeProject(String repositoryId,
String namespace,
String projectId) |
void |
MetadataRepository.removeProject(String repositoryId,
String namespace,
String projectId)
remove a project
|
void |
AbstractMetadataRepository.removeProjectVersion(String repoId,
String namespace,
String projectId,
String projectVersion) |
void |
MetadataRepository.removeProjectVersion(String repoId,
String namespace,
String projectId,
String projectVersion) |
void |
AbstractMetadataRepository.removeRepository(String repositoryId) |
void |
MetadataRepository.removeRepository(String repositoryId)
Delete a repository's metadata.
|
List<org.apache.archiva.metadata.model.ArtifactMetadata> |
AbstractMetadataRepository.searchArtifacts(String text,
String repositoryId,
boolean exact) |
List<org.apache.archiva.metadata.model.ArtifactMetadata> |
MetadataRepository.searchArtifacts(String text,
String repositoryId,
boolean exact)
Full text artifacts search.
|
List<org.apache.archiva.metadata.model.ArtifactMetadata> |
AbstractMetadataRepository.searchArtifacts(String key,
String text,
String repositoryId,
boolean exact) |
List<org.apache.archiva.metadata.model.ArtifactMetadata> |
MetadataRepository.searchArtifacts(String key,
String text,
String repositoryId,
boolean exact)
Full text artifacts search inside the specified key.
|
void |
AbstractMetadataRepository.updateArtifact(String repositoryId,
String namespace,
String projectId,
String projectVersion,
org.apache.archiva.metadata.model.ArtifactMetadata artifactMeta) |
void |
MetadataRepository.updateArtifact(String repositoryId,
String namespace,
String projectId,
String projectVersion,
org.apache.archiva.metadata.model.ArtifactMetadata artifactMeta) |
void |
AbstractMetadataRepository.updateNamespace(String repositoryId,
String namespace) |
void |
MetadataRepository.updateNamespace(String repositoryId,
String namespace)
create the namespace in the repository.
|
void |
AbstractMetadataRepository.updateProject(String repositoryId,
org.apache.archiva.metadata.model.ProjectMetadata project) |
void |
MetadataRepository.updateProject(String repositoryId,
org.apache.archiva.metadata.model.ProjectMetadata project)
Update metadata for a particular project in the metadata repository, or create it if it does not already exist.
|
void |
AbstractMetadataRepository.updateProjectVersion(String repositoryId,
String namespace,
String projectId,
org.apache.archiva.metadata.model.ProjectVersionMetadata versionMetadata) |
void |
MetadataRepository.updateProjectVersion(String repositoryId,
String namespace,
String projectId,
org.apache.archiva.metadata.model.ProjectVersionMetadata versionMetadata) |
Copyright © 2006–2023 The Apache Software Foundation. All rights reserved.